through the window i see a church
yet close the curtains i see it not
the glorious and the sacred in a ditch
up above the stars aglow
glistening also down below
the light crept and sneaked into our bed
it bursted out from your solid body
the light was a feeling
i could feel it even though the window
through the glass
so warm and so strong
like the birth of a new star from stardust
such is the melody we both trust
now that we’ve arrived at the church
by means of miraculously flaming reins
close the curtains we see it still
and something real has connected our veins
